My Buying Guides on Usb To Gamecube Converter

Why I Look for a USB to GameCube Converter

When I shop for a USB to GameCube converter, I want something that lets me use my classic GameCube controller on modern devices without hassle. For me, the main appeal is keeping the feel of an original controller while making it work with a PC, emulator, or other USB-supported setup. I always look for a converter that feels simple, reliable, and responsive.

Compatibility Matters Most to Me

The first thing I check is compatibility. I make sure the converter works with the device I plan to use, whether that is Windows, Mac, Linux, or a console-adjacent setup. I also pay attention to whether it supports official GameCube controllers, WaveBird controllers, or third-party versions. If a converter is not compatible with my system, I skip it right away.

Input Lag Is a Big Deal

I care a lot about input lag because even a small delay can ruin the experience, especially in fast-paced games. I look for converters that are known for low latency and stable performance. If I see reviews mentioning delayed inputs or inconsistent button response, I usually avoid that product.

Build Quality and Cable Length

In my experience, build quality tells me a lot about how long a converter will last. I prefer a sturdy shell, secure controller ports, and a USB cable that does not feel flimsy. I also check the cable length because I do not want to sit too close to my screen just to keep the controller connected comfortably.

Plug-and-Play vs. Driver Installation

I always ask myself whether I want a plug-and-play device or if I am okay installing drivers. Personally, I prefer plug-and-play because it saves time and reduces setup problems. Some converters need extra software, firmware updates, or configuration, so I make sure I am comfortable with that before buying.

Number of Ports I Need

I think about how many controllers I plan to use at once. If I only need one controller, a single-port converter may be enough. But if I want multiplayer gaming, I look for a multi-port adapter so I can connect several GameCube controllers without buying extra accessories later.

Controller Support and Features

I also check whether the converter supports rumble, analog triggers, and button mapping. These features matter to me because they help preserve the original GameCube feel. Some converters also offer turbo functions, switch modes, or customizable settings, which can be useful depending on how I play.

Price and Value for Money

I do not always choose the cheapest option. Instead, I look for the best value. A slightly more expensive converter is worth it to me if it offers better accuracy, durability, and compatibility. I compare prices with reviews so I can tell whether the extra cost is actually justified.

What I Read in Reviews Before Buying

Before I make a purchase, I read user reviews carefully. I pay attention to comments about connection stability, lag, driver issues, and long-term durability. If many people mention the same problem, I take that as a warning sign. On the other hand, consistent praise for responsiveness and easy setup usually gives me confidence.

My Final Buying Advice

If I were choosing a USB to GameCube converter today, I would focus on compatibility, low latency, solid build quality, and easy setup first. Then I would decide how many ports I need and whether I want extra features like rumble or remapping. For me, the best converter is the one that makes my GameCube controller feel natural on a modern device without any frustration.
